A developer has created a chaos engineering harness called Balagan for multi-agent AI systems, designed to test their resilience against various faults. The system uses three different network topologies (flat, hierarchical, ring) and three fault conditions (baseline, crash-stop, and Byzantine) to evaluate agent performance. The experiments, run using Qwen2.5-7B-Instruct models, revealed that a Byzantine agent, subtly prompted to act as a saboteur, could significantly degrade system performance without requiring model modification. The harness was built on Nebius Serverless, demonstrating efficient and cost-effective execution for this type of workload. AI
